Ryan Ludwick and Rick Ankiel are expected to play tonight when the St. Louis Cardinals open a three-game set at AT&T Park against the resurgent San Francisco Giants.

St. Louis, winner of two in a row and seven of nine, took a one-game lead in the division over Milwaukee with Wednesday's 3-2 victory against the Brewers. The Cardinals' pitching has been outstanding during this nine-game stretch, posting an 0.88 ERA.

St. Louis is looking for a spark from its offense, but that could be difficult as it faces Matt Cain in the series opener. Cain is 3-0 with a 1.61 ERA in his last four starts.

The Giants look for their season-best fifth straight victory at home after winning all three against Atlanta.
